Work That Endures Is a Map of the World

“Work that endures…is a mirror that reflects the reader’s own traits and it is also a map of the world…As long as an author merely relates events or traces the slight deviations of a conscience, we can suppose him to be omniscient…but when he descends to the level of pure reason, we know he is fallible. Reality is inferred from events, not reasoning; we permit God to affirm ‘I am that I am’, not to declare and analyze, like Hegel or Anselm.”

–Jorge Louis Borges, “The First Wells” (Borges: A Reader, 172)
